About the Role
As an Admin Clerk / Receptionist for Lancet Laboratories in Richards Bay, you will serve as the primary operational link between patients, healthcare professionals, hospital wards, and processing laboratories.
You will manage the reception desk, register incoming diagnostic samples on the Laboratory Information System (LIS), sort and dispatch specimens to maintain strict turnaround times, and resolve pre-analytical process bottlenecks. Additionally, you will perform hospital rounds to deliver reports and collect samples, track courier deliveries, scan patient documents using the Oculus system, and handle financial cash receipts and daily banking.
Company Values & Compliance: Lancet Laboratories expects all employees to interact ethically and professionally with medical professionals, maintain total patient confidentiality, and adhere strictly to Lancet uniform protocols and quality standard operating procedures (SOPs).
Key Performance Areas & Responsibilities
Specimen Logging & Pre-Analytical Processing
-
Administer the receiving, sorting, and prioritized distribution of medical specimens according to set SOPs.
-
Register (“log”) incoming patient samples and address pre-analytical queries on the Laboratory Information System.
-
Track courier sample deliveries to ensure specimens reach designated processing labs without delay.
-
Investigate and resolve pre-analytical bottlenecks to uphold strict diagnostic turnaround times.
Frontline Reception & Patient Customer Care
-
Welcome patients and clients, provide clear information, and direct them to appropriate departments.
-
Manage nervous or distressed patients with empathy, patience, and high emotional intelligence.
-
Capture patient data, prepare and scan request forms into the Oculus system, and resolve scanning incompletes.
-
Receive cash payments from patients and manage daily banking in accordance with financial protocols.
Hospital Rounds & Stock Management
-
Perform scheduled hospital rounds to deliver lab reports to doctors and collect submitted specimens from wards.
-
Monitor branch stock levels, order additional laboratory materials, and ensure timely stock delivery to doctors’ rooms.
-
Maintain clean, orderly workstations and sanitize equipment according to health and safety SOPs.
-
Log incidents, customer complaints, and resolutions on the management system in compliance with company policy.
